Defense Cyber Security Market Analysis and Forecast to 2035: Type, Product, Services, Technology, Component, Application, Deployment, End User, Solutions, Mode

The Defense Cyber Security Market is projected to expand from $27.5 billion in 2025 to $54.2 billion by 2035, reflecting a CAGR of approximately 7.3%. In 2025, the Defense Cyber Security Market demonstrated robust dynamics, with the market volume reaching significant levels. The network security segment commands the largest market share at 45%, followed by endpoint security at 30%, and application security at 25%. This distribution underscores the prioritization of comprehensive security frameworks across defense sectors. Enhanced threat detection and response capabilities are pivotal, driving demand for advanced cybersecurity solutions. Key players such as Northrop Grumman, Raytheon Technologies, and Lockheed Martin dominate the landscape, leveraging cutting-edge technologies to fortify defense systems against sophisticated cyber threats.\n\nCompetitive pressures and regulatory frameworks significantly impact the market. Regulatory bodies are intensifying compliance standards, focusing on national security and data protection. Future projections indicate a steady growth trajectory, with an anticipated comp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10% over the next decade. Investments in art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) for threat intelligence are expected to redefine market dynamics. The emphasis on cyber resilience and strategic partnerships will be crucial in navigating the evolving threat landscape, ensuring sustained market expansion.

Geographical Overview

North America dominates the defense cyber security market. The United States leads with significant investments in cyber defense technologies. The region's focus on protecting critical infrastructure and national security drives growth. Government initiatives and collaborations with private firms enhance cyber capabilities.\n\nEurope follows closely, with the United Kingdom, Germany, and France at the forefront. These countries prioritize safeguarding military networks and sensitive data. The European Union's regulatory frameworks and funding programs support market expansion. Increasing cyber threats necessitate robust defense strategies.\n\nThe Asia Pacific region is rapidly emerging as a key player. China, India, and Japan invest heavily in cyber security to protect their growing digital landscapes. Regional tensions and the need for advanced defense solutions fuel market demand. Collaborative efforts between governments and tech companies are pivotal.\n\nIn the Middle East, countries like Israel and the UAE lead in cyber defense innovation. Geopolitical factors and regional conflicts underscore the importance of cyber security. Investments in cutting-edge technologies and skilled workforce development bolster market growth. The region's strategic partnerships with global players enhance its capabilities.\n\nLatin America is gradually recognizing the importance of defense cyber security. Brazil and Mexico are making strides to improve their cyber infrastructure. Economic growth and digital transformation initiatives drive market interest. However, challenges such as budget constraints and limited expertise persist in the region.

Key Trends and Drivers

The Defense Cyber Security Market is experiencing robust growth fueled by escalating cyber threats and geopolitical tensions. As cyber warfare becomes a strategic tool, nations are investing heavily in advanced cyber defense mechanisms to protect critical infrastructure. Key trends include the integration of artificial intelligence and machine learning to enhance threat detection and response capabilities. These technologies enable real-time analysis and predictive analytics, allowing for proactive threat mitigation.\n\nMoreover, the rise of cloud computing and the proliferation of Internet of Things (IoT) devices are expanding the attack surface, necessitating comprehensive security solutions. Governments and defense organizations are prioritizing cybersecurity frameworks that encompass both traditional IT infrastructure and emerging technologies. The increasing adoption of zero-trust architectures is another significant trend, emphasizing the need for rigorous access controls and continuous monitoring.\n\nOpportunities abound in developing innovative solutions that address the unique challenges of the defense sector, such as securing communications and safeguarding sensitive data. Companies that offer scalable, adaptable, and interoperable systems are well-positioned to capture market share. Additionally, the growing emphasis on cybersecurity collaboration and information sharing among nations presents avenues for partnerships and joint ventures, further driving market expansion.
